Where the Polestar VIN number is located
The VIN in Polestar is hidden in several places in the car. It can be found:
- Under the windshield on the driver's side.
- At the bottom of the driver's door pillar (sill).
- Under the carpet in the passenger compartment.
- In the glove compartment.
- On a special plate.
- On the center console in the armrest or instrument panel area.
- Under the hood: on the front bulkhead of the engine compartment or near the engine.
- In the vehicle documents: technical passport, service book, insurance policy.

Polestar VIN decoding
Each Polestar VIN is divided into several logical blocks:
- WMI (World Manufacturer Identifier) – the first three characters, which indicate the manufacturer and country of assembly.
- VDS (Vehicle Descriptor Section) – characters 4 to 9, reflecting the main characteristics of the car: model, body type, engine.
- Check digit – verifies the correctness of the VIN.
- VIS (Vehicle Identifier Section) – the final characters indicating the year of manufacture, factory, and serial number of the vehicle.
Deciphering the Polestar VIN gives the buyer a complete picture of the vehicle and its authenticity.
